I recently did a review and giveaway for winter gear, who went out and bought their hats, gloves, and scarves since then?  If you didn’t, you should really get after it. Old man winter has definately settled in here!  BRRRRR.....!

I was sent a wool knit “Matty Hat” from Knoodle Knits for review! Christine (owner) has been so kind and very helpful throughout our conversations and ordering process...she’s a pleasure to work with!
Here is a picture of the hat that we received.  Hard to tell in the pictures, but the hat is actually plum colored and medium pink.


The hat is very well made, the stitches are even and flawless. The Matty Hat has cute gathers in the corners that are tied off with coordinating yarn, they add a fun little detail to the hat!

The brim is quite wide and can be worn either up or down. Right now the hat is plenty big for my daughter, so she wears it up. I’m guessing she’ll still be able to wear the hat next winter and then we can pull the brim down.  I was going to include a photo of my little one wearing the hat, but Blogger is not agreeing with me tonight.


If you live “up north”, your little one(s) will love having a wool hat, they are so nice and toasty, all while remaining soft enough for delicate skin.

First off, how many of you out there know what Feminine Cloth or Mama Cloth is? I didn’t until a few months ago, so for those of you in the dark, I will shed some light on the subject. Feminine cloth is reusable, washable, and a great eco-friendly alternative to dealing with monthly visits from “Aunt Flo”.

I have been a dedicated user of tampons for years and years, practically right from the beginning, so trying out Feminine Cloth was a big adjustment for me. I think it is one that I could get use to for the following reasons.

1. It is popular belief that the chemicals found in disposable suppositories actually make your period heavier and last longer since it throws your body all out of whack.  Say goodbye to TSS (Toxic Shock Syndrome) warnings on the products you use!

2. Better for the environment. Just like disposable diapers, suppositories add to landfill waste and can be prevented.

3. Easy to use. All you do is unfold, connect the wings via a snap and you are done!

4. Cute! Feminine cloth is becoming as popular as cloth diapers these days. You can find all sorts of styles and fabrics! The package I was sent from For the Monster have shiny floral patterns.

5. Just like disposables, they come in all shapes and sizes. I’ve seen regular, lights, liners, heavy, postpartum and even thongs!

6. Clean up is a piece of cake. Just like with cloth diapers, you don’t want to use a detergent that is going to leave a film on them, otherwise they will start to repel moisture. Make sure you use a diaper safe detergent and you’re golden.

Okay, are you curious to see what Feminine Cloth looks like? Here’s some pictures taken of them expanded and folded up. That’s right…they snap to themselves and look like a little envelope when not in use, which is very convenient for storage and travel. Plus after use, it keeps everything inside where it should be.




If you are concerned about what to do about getting your FC back and forth from the bathroom or what to do when you are traveling, they make mini wetbags that are lined with a waterproof material so that you don’t have leaks and no one will be the wiser. Some wetbags even have a dry compartment for unused product. To everyone else, they will just think it’s your purse/clutch!

I have to admit, I thought I would have a major problem with cleaning the FC. I mean, how do you get bright red out of white cloth? Well, I’m not sure what happened in the washing machine, but it was taken care of. They came out just as white as if they were new!

All in all, it’s definitely an adjustment, but I think it is one that is well worth it!
